Warema was founded in Germany in 1955. The company name is a combination of the initials of founders Karl-Friedrich Wagner and Hans Wilhelm Renkhoff, as well as the place where it all began: Marktheidenfeld. Today, daughter Angelique Renkhoff-Mücke heads the family business, which employs more than 4,500 people in more than 50 countries worldwide. Warema Netherlands was formed several years ago from an acquisition of Delta Nederland BV. The company's ambition is not only to be the sun center for the Netherlands, but also for the Benelux. The new location in Weert is an excellent base for this.
For several years, Warema has been the global market leader in indoor and outdoor awnings," Rozema said. "Our product range can be broadly divided into two categories: facade sun protection (ZIP screens, roller shutters, outdoor blinds and marquise nets) and outdoor living solutions (pergolas, cassette screens, articulated screens, slatted roofs, sun protection for conservatories and sun sails). In addition, we have developed our own control system, Warema Mobile System (WMS), which combines state-of-the-art technology and aesthetic design in a high-quality and wireless control system."
